Functional Description ? help Back to Top
Source Description
UniProtEssential for the formation and the abaxial-adaxial asymmetric growth of the ovule outer integument. {ECO:0000269|PubMed:10601041, ECO:0000269|PubMed:12183380, ECO:0000269|PubMed:9093862, ECO:0000269|PubMed:9118807}.
Regulation -- Description ? help Back to Top
Source Description
UniProtINDUCTION: Autoinduction down-regulated by SUP in adaxial region of the ovule outer integument. Negatively and spatially regulated by HLL, ANT, BELL1, NZZ/SPL and SUP. {ECO:0000269|PubMed:10601041, ECO:0000269|PubMed:12183380, ECO:0000269|PubMed:12183381}.
